4.7 Kg Heroin Seized in Jalandhar, Key Associate of Gangster Jaggu Bhagwanpuria’s Network Arrested

Jalandhar: In a significant breakthrough against narcotics trafficking, Punjab’s Counter-Intelligence unit in Patiala has arrested a suspected drug courier and seized 4.721 kilograms of heroin during an intelligence-led operation in Jalandhar.

The accused, identified as Vansh Kumar, a resident of Dalam in Batala, was taken into custody based on actionable intelligence. According to officials, preliminary investigations have linked Vansh to Amrit Dalam — a Dubai-based handler originally from Batala — who is believed to be a close associate of notorious gangster Jaggu Bhagwanpuria, currently lodged in jail.

An FIR has been registered at the State Special Operation Cell (SSOC) in Amritsar, and further investigation is ongoing to trace the full extent of the drug network. Authorities are focused on identifying both the source and the intended recipients of the consignment, along with uncovering the backward and forward linkages of the syndicate.

The Punjab Police, in a statement, reiterated its firm commitment to combating organised drug trafficking operations in the state. Officials confirmed that more arrests and seizures are likely as the probe progresses.

This latest operation marks another step in the state’s ongoing campaign to dismantle criminal networks operating from both domestic and international locations.
